WebSep 17, 2024 · America is a country where traveling just an hour or two can warrant different dialects, and sometimes even an entirely new repertoire of words and phrases. … WebThe term "Virgin Islands Creole" is formal terminology used by scholars and academics, and is rarely used in everyday speech. Informally, the creole is known by the term dialect, as the creole is often perceived by locals as a dialect variety of English instead of an English creole language. When Colombian photographer Felipe Romero Beltrán met nine young Moroccan migrants in southern Spain, he felt a sense of kinship that led him to embark on a three-year-long project.
